Govt to start bus, heli services, warns against disruption
Source: Chronicle News Service
Imphal, March 07 2025:
The government has announced the commencement of inter-district bus services under CAPF escort and helicopter operations to alleviate public inconveniences and support efforts to restore normalcy in the state.
According to a press release of the chief secretary, the bus service will be operated by Manipur State Transport (MST) on designated routes from March 8, starting at 9 AM from Imphal Airport.
The bus routes include Imphal-Kangpokpi-Senapati, Senapati-Kangpokpi-Imphal, Imphal-Bishnupur-Churachandpur, and Churachandpur-Bishnupur-Imphal.
Additionally, the government has reiterated the launch of helicopter services under the Manipur Heli Service every Wednesday and Saturday, starting on March 8 in between Imphal and Churachandpur, and between Imphal and Ukhrul on Saturdays, to provide better connectivity to remote areas.
The press release encouraged the public to avail of these transport services.
It also warned that anyone found disrupting the movement of MST buses will be prosecuted under relevant laws.
